Rasmalai Recipe

Ingredients :

6 cups milk

lemon juice

10 ml plain or all purpose flour

8 green cardamoms, crushed

2-3 sugar cubes, cut in 12 small pieces

570 ml milk, reduced by boiling to 430 ml  - milk sauce

350 g granulated sugar and 280 ml water  - syrup

Garnish :

few drops rosewater or orange flower water

30 g pistachio nuts, chopped

30 g almonds, chopped

Method :
  1. Bring the 6 cups or 1 3/4 liter or milk to the boil and add lemon juice.
  2. Leave to stand to separate.
  3. Cool for 10 minutes and then strain through a fine sieve or a clean piece of muslin or cheese cloth.
  4. Leave to drain overnight.
  5. Boil the milk to reduce it and prepare the sugar syrup.
  6. Combine the granulated sugar and water in a saucepan and cook for 2-3 minutes to dissolve the sugar.
  7. Turn up the heat and allow to boil for about 3 minutes or until syrupy.
  8. Transfer the drained milk mixture to a bowl and beat with an electric mixer or wooden spoon for about 5 minutes to soften.
  9. Add the flour and the cardamom seeds gradually, and continue mashing.
  10. Set aside for 2-3 minutes.
  11. Divide the mixture into 12 equal sizes balls.
  12. Place a piece of sugar cube in the center of each ball and then press gently to flatten it into a 4 cm round.
  13. Continue until all the milk mixture is drained.
  14. Bring the sugar syrup back to simmering point and drop in the rasmalai balls, a few at a time.
  15. Allow them to boil for 10 minutes.
  16. Transfer the milk sauce to a serving dish.
  17. Remove the rasmalai from the syrup and place in the milk sauce.
  18. When all the rasmalai are cooked and in the milk sauce, sprinkle with rose or orange flower water and the chopped nuts.
  19. Allow to cool and refrigerate before serving.

Serves 4
